Hackensack ribbon cutting ceremony June 25th
Join us on Saturday, June 25th at 10:30 a.m., when the Hackensack City Council cuts the celebratory red ribbon for the completion of the redesign of First Street. This project included expanding the east sidewalk 10 additional feet toward the lakefront which creates a boulevard atmosphere for pedestrians, benches, tables, chairs and flower planters. Twenty decorative light posts line the streets that were slated for improvements that also include new sidewalks, curbs, drainage and handicap access that is up to code. Civic minded volunteers joined in to plant trees spaced along the sidewalks that will be enjoyed by future generations.
